Mango Processing Factories - Cambodia and China

Mango Processing Factories - Cambodia and China

A worker slices a mango at a mango processing factory in Phnom Sruoch district in Kampong Speu province, Cambodia, March 18, 2025. In western Cambodia's Phnom Sruoch district, the abundant sunshine, plentiful rainfall, and fertile soil provide ideal natural conditions for mango cultivation, yielding mangoes featuring tender flesh and rich aroma. At the mango processing factory, invested and constructed by China's Zhong Bao Fujian) Food Science & Technology Co. Ltd., in western Cambodia's Phnom Sruoch district, ripe mangoes undergo processes such as washing, peeling, slicing, sugar curing, and drying, finally transforming into sweet and chewy dried mango slices. These dried mangoes are then transported via sea shipping to Zhong Bao Fujian) Food Science & Technology Co. Ltd. in southeast China's Fujian Province. After undergoing sorting, packaging, and packing, they can reach the shelves of Chinese supermarkets within days. The Chinese-invested mango processing factory was put into use in January, 2021. Tiles Fall Off The Exterior Wall of A High-rise Residential Building in Yichang, China

Tiles Fall Off The Exterior Wall of A High-rise Residential Building in Yichang, China

YICHANG, CHINA - JULY 19, 2023 - Tiles fall off the exterior wall of a high-rise residential building in Yichang, Hubei province, China, July 19, 2023. With the gradual aging of housing construction, the peeling of exterior walls has become a prominent problem. The exterior wall falling off mainly occurs in two forms of building facades: one is tile exterior wall and the other is sticky anchor exterior wall structure. With extreme weather such as high temperature and heavy rain, the frequency of external wall shedding events increases.

Demonstration room for Omiya Kogyo's semiconductor and electronic component manufacturing equipment

Demonstration room for Omiya Kogyo's semiconductor and electronic component manufacturing equipment

Omiya Industries (Fukuyama City, Hiroshima Prefecture) has remodeled its demonstration room for semiconductor and electronic parts manufacturing equipment in its Okayama Plant (Kasaoka City, Okayama Prefecture). The area of the room has been increased by 4.8 times compared to the previous one. This will allow customers to check and evaluate the operability, productivity, and maintainability of the actual equipment, which will lead to the introduction of the equipment. In order to maintain confidentiality, customers are increasingly bringing in their own samples for testing, and we have established a system that allows us to concentrate on testing. Omiya Kogyo develops and manufactures equipment for attaching and peeling off protective tapes for silicon wafers, ultraviolet (UV) irradiation equipment for curing films, wafer expanders, and dryers for cleaned wafers. Dai-ichi Sheet Metal's "Bottle Friend LSE" for peeling off labels without crushing plastic bottles.jpg

Dai-ichi Sheet Metal's "Bottle Friend LSE" for peeling off labels without crushing plastic bottles.jpg

Daiichikin (Tsuzuki-ku, Yokohama) has developed a new model "LSE (Label Separator)" in its "Bottle Friend" series of devices that automatically remove labels from PET bottles. Unlike conventional models, it can remove labels without crushing the bottles. The price is about 2.5 million yen (excluding consumption tax). It will be marketed to PET bottle collectors and businesses that recycle and use bottles as materials. The sales target is yet to be determined. Delivery time after receiving an order is two to three months. The company has already started receiving orders and is making proposals to its customers. The device consists of a cylindrical "outer cylinder" and a rotating octagonal "inner cylinder" inside the outer cylinder. Hiroshige - 53 Stations of the Tokaido - Print 51

Hiroshige - 53 Stations of the Tokaido - Print 51

51 Minakuchi - A solitary traveller walking through the village, where women are peeling and drying gourds; in the backgound a range of hills, printed in colour-block only. This station located in a desolate rural area was famous for its production of dried gourd shavings for use on Japanese dishes. Women are busy making them: one is shaving a gourd, one is helping the shavers, and one is drying the shaved gourd on a rope. Utagawa Hiroshige (1797 - 1858). The Fifty-Three Stations of the Tokaido - Hoeido edition (1831-4) Date: 1831 - 1834

TEPCO releases video of interior of Fukushima No. 2 reactor

TEPCO releases video of interior of Fukushima No. 2 reactor

TOKYO, Japan - Photo taken from the video that Tokyo Electric Power Co. posted on its website on Jan. 20, 2012, shows the inner wall of the primary container of the No. 2 reactor at the Fukushima Daiichi nuclear power plant. The coating looks to be peeling, presumably due to high temperature and humidity. The previous day, the company inserted an industrial endoscope into the reactor that suffered meltdown following the March 2011 earthquake and tsunami, in the first attempt by the plant's operator to directly check the interiors of the crippled reactors at the complex. Due to the effects of radiation, the image is blurry and has many spots. (Photo courtesy of Tokyo Electric Power Co.)(Kyodo)
